Definition of 'novice'

(from WordNet)
noun
Someone who has entered a religious order but has not taken final vows [syn: novitiate, novice]
noun
Someone new to a field or activity [syn: novice, beginner, tyro, tiro, initiate]

Definition of 'Novice'

From: GCIDE
  • Novice \Nov"ice\, n. [F., from L. novicius, novitius, new, from novus new. See New, and cf. Novitious.]
  • 1. One who is new in any business, profession, or calling; one unacquainted or unskilled; one yet in the rudiments; a beginner; a tyro. [1913 Webster]
  • I am young; a novice in the trade. --Dryden. [1913 Webster]
  • 2. One newly received into the church, or one newly converted to the Christian faith. --1 Tim. iii. 6. [1913 Webster]
  • 3. (Eccl.) One who enters a religious house, whether of monks or nuns, as a probationist. --Shipley. [1913 Webster]
  • No poore cloisterer, nor no novys. --Chaucer. [1913 Webster]

Novice, TX -- U.S. city in Texas

From: Gazetteer 2000
Name :
Novice, TX -- U.S. city in Texas
Population (2000) :
142
Housing Units (2000) :
65
Land area (2000) :
0.451929 sq. miles (1.170491 sq. km)
Water area (2000) :
0.000000 sq. miles (0.000000 sq. km)
Total area (2000) :
0.451929 sq. miles (1.170491 sq. km)
FIPS code :
52668
Located within :
Texas (TX), FIPS 48
Location :
31.988664 N, 99.625334 W
